No less than 151 proposals have been submitted in response to SESAME’s third call (Call “2”) for experiments on its three beamlines that closed on 27 January, thus confirming the ever-increasing demand for use of its facilities.

On Monday, 23rd December 2019, at 13:21, scientists at the SESAME light source successfully delivered the first X-ray monochromatic beam to the experimental station of the Materials Science (MS) beamline, that will be used in applications of the X-ray powder diffraction (XRD) technique in materials science.

20 researchers from the SESAME Members and beyond received comprehensive training in the use of synchrotron radiation at the OPEN SESAME HERCULES School (Higher European Research Course for Users of Large Experimental Systems) held at SESAME from October 26 to November 8, 2019.
